Transaction f26dcc8de6c344b0b5fcad61f2503ea1bc9a760160be5c051e64adf694f1822d
1 Input
1 Output
-
f26dcc8de6c344b0b5fcad61f2503ea1bc9a760160be5c051e64adf694f1822d:0
- value
- 567841
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4a6f2b0bd4a1add4a49a6a3e4726dcbfe37eb881eb64a00b47afbba1cf472427
- address
- bc1pffhjkz755xkaffy6dglywfkuhl3hawypadj2qz6847a6rn68ysnsmz0lyc